**Vendor note: Inkmill markdown pipeline**

Rendering for Parchway docs is outsourced to Inkmill under an annual contract, renewing each March. They handle sanitization and PDF export; we own the upload queue. SLA: 4-hour response on rendering failures. Escalate only after two failed retries. Their support desk is reachable at the address below.

billing contact of hahaf-baguf = zorael.tammir.jorius@sivrelhq.internal

Subject: Font vendoring cut-over done

Hey — quick recap before you review. We finished the cut-over on Glyphbarn today: all third-party fonts are now vendored into the repo instead of pulled from the Typewell CDN at build time. Licenses are checked into docs/fonts, and the fetch step is gone from CI. Builds are about 40s faster. The service picks everything up from the values below.

deployment values, kagap-hahif:
[queneth]
port = 5672
region = south-4
host = queneth.qirvantech.local
team = istir
timeout_ms = 1500
retries = 2

Meeting notes — Permit prep, Thursday

Quick recap for Marla: the revised blueprints for the Dovetail Annex are finally stamped and ready. Tobben from Kestrel Drafting dropped off two full sets; one stays in the plan cabinet, the other goes to the permit office in Hallowmere by Friday. Budget for printing came in under estimate, nice. When the courier arrives, this instruction applies to the hand-over.

courier memo of yawep-yafog: the pramir ulaix courier leaves the ulavan aldix frair zorok oliiel joreth rusdor fenvan ledger at gate 1305 under passcode 514738